Plongez dans l’univers captivant de Google Gravity, une expérience en ligne fascinante qui transforme la traditionnelle page d’accueil de Google en un terrain de jeu interactif soumis aux lois de la gravité. Imaginez voir les éléments visuels de votre moteur de recherche préféré chuter et réagir comme s’ils obéissaient aux mêmes forces physiques que dans le monde réel.
Mais Google Gravity va bien au-delà du simple divertissement : c’est une démonstration magistrale de l’interaction entre le design web et des concepts scientifiques fondamentaux, rendue possible grâce à JavaScript et des bibliothèques comme Box2D
et Matter.js
.
Que vous soyez développeur, enseignant ou simple curieux, cet article vous guide dans les coulisses techniques et pédagogiques d’un projet web devenu culte.
Google Gravity : découvrez l’expérience interactive de la pesanteur numérique
Ouvrez Google, tapez “Google Gravity”, cliquez sur “J’ai de la chance” : les éléments chutent sous l’effet d’une gravité simulée ! Cette démonstration allie technologie et immersion pour offrir une interaction amusante et didactique.
Le concept de Google Gravity : comprendre les fondations
JavaScript : le moteur derrière Google Gravity
Google Gravity utilise JavaScript pour appliquer des forces simulées aux éléments HTML. Les bibliothèques comme Box2D
ou Matter.js
gèrent la physique des objets : masse, friction, élasticité…
Interaction utilisateur : une expérience unique et éducative
Les visiteurs peuvent déplacer, lancer ou faire rebondir les éléments. Une belle façon d’explorer le fonctionnement du DOM et de la physique appliquée au design web.
Comment utiliser Google Gravity : guide pas Ă pas
- Ouvrez un navigateur web
- Allez sur Google.fr
- Saisissez Google Gravity
- Cliquez sur “J’ai de la chance”
- Interagissez avec les éléments de la page effondrée
Explorez les fonctionnalités cachées
Faites glisser les éléments, empilez-les ou lancez-les pour observer les collisions et rebonds réalistes.
Expérimentations et découvertes personnelles
Lancez le logo contre d’autres Ă©lĂ©ments, crĂ©ez des chutes en chaĂ®ne, testez les limites physiques dĂ©finies par le script.
Le côté technique : qu’est-ce qui se cache derrière Google Gravity
Les bibliothèques JavaScript utilisées
Box2D
est robuste et précis, Matter.js
est plus simple et facile à intégrer. Les deux permettent des simulations réalistes via des calculs physiques temps réel.
Personnalisation et extensions
Les développeurs peuvent enrichir l’expérience avec des sons, des objets interactifs supplémentaires ou des effets spéciaux liés aux mouvements.
Les applications éducatives de Google Gravity
Approfondir la compréhension des principes physiques
La gravité, l’inertie ou les collisions deviennent tangibles à travers l’expérimentation visuelle. Un outil idéal pour les cours de physique et sciences.
Intégration dans les modules de cours
Les enseignants peuvent créer des exercices où les élèves formulent des hypothèses sur les mouvements avant de les tester dans Google Gravity.